  • Title

    An Inequality for the Calculation of Relative Maximum Sideband Level in Time-Modulated Linear and Planar Arrays

  • Abstract
    In this work, the maximum point of relative sideband level (SBL) with respect to maximum level of main radiation (the radiation in carrier frequency) in time-modulated linear and planar arrays is examined. An inequality is derived which may be used for the determination and suppression of maximum relative sideband level. Performance analysis in terms of sideband level, harmonic power loss, directivity and feed network efficiency are conducted with state of the art methods to compare and to demonstrate the potential of the presented formulation for linear and planar cases.
